Output 6150fc5d5f93026fc6c8dc84c5f3e9409202e66edcfeeb8b2f206bd04676c414:10

value
205114623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ecc2f3ea85a81af7555aa52fb5cdd8faff64dba OP_EQUAL
address
3DFTfhsyGg8NYSPyMhsZ3Cdcru9uXrDrbD
transaction
6150fc5d5f93026fc6c8dc84c5f3e9409202e66edcfeeb8b2f206bd04676c414
spent
true